How the Process Works

Step 1: Submit Your Details

Clients begin by filling out the enquiry form with basic information regarding their requirement—whether they intend to transfer a trademark or acquire one.

Step 2: Initial Review & Connection

Our team reviews the submitted details and connects with the client to understand the requirement, scope, and procedural next steps.

Step 3: Trademark Discussion & Alignment

Based on the requirement, relevant trademark details or transfer-related aspects are discussed and aligned to ensure procedural readiness.

Step 4: Documentation & Execution

Once procedural terms are aligned, the required assignment and transfer documents are prepared. These documents are then executed through signing and notarisation, as applicable.

Step 5: Filing & Completion

Executed documents are filed on the government trademark portal, and the process is carried forward in accordance with prescribed statutory timelines and procedures.
